Our first-team head coach Joaquín Caparrós, spoke to the media ahead of the match against Deportivo Alavés. He began by analysing the work done in his first week back: "There is a great willingness and hunger among this group. I am confident that there is a lot of quality here. We have worked very well. Time is a fundamental element. I'm very happy with the mentality of the players".

Caparrós also spoke about the quality of the homegrown talents: 'They have played a leading role so far. The lads who are here are not here to make up the numbers or just gain experience. The youth players have my confidence, as well as that of the coaching staff and their teammates. We are going to continue to trust in the youth academy because there is a lot of talent."

He also emphasised the roles played by the likes of Suso: "He is a Sevilla FC player. They are players who are ours and, in a situation like the one we're in with the number of games left... I've spoken to all of them and I've been delighted with their mindsets. I have spoken to all of them on an individual level. I'm happy with his attitude and behaviour."

He also assessed the recovery process of Rubén Vargas: "It's difficult to know when he will return. He's getting better every day. I talk to him every day. We mustn't put pressure on him."

Reflecting on the form of tomorrow's opposition, the Sevilla icon said he was determined to break our current losing streak: "Alavés' mood is good, they are doing things well. They are a team that have evolved well. They are a team that competes well. We have to break the cycle, and we're going into these upcoming games with a positive attitude. Let's hope we have a good game tomorrow.

"The atmosphere on the pitch is going to be spectacular, the fans will support the players because I know the Sevilla FC fans. The fans have the right to demonstrate, but I am aware that on the pitch they will be with the players for sure," he continued. Joaquín Caparrós also confirmed that the final training sessions before the league games will be held at the Ramón Sánchez-Pizjuán: "We're going to train here on the eve of the game. We will come to our stadium. Coming to my home stadium gives me a lot of excitement. For those of us who are Sevillistas, it's a great joy. I'm looking forward to giving back to the fans for everything they have given us".

Questioned again about the youth team, he was happy about the growth of players such as Juanlu, Kike Salas and Manu Bueno: "It's a joy to see how they have been growing. Juanlu, Kike and Manu are people we have worked with individually a lot. I have the chance to train them and line up with them. It's important and says a lot about a youth academy that has always had a lot of talent. There are lads with a lot of quality and a great future."
